E-liquid Prohibited Additive Screening Device

By designing a screening instrument for prohibited additives in e-liquid, and using dropper sampling and test strips to detect multiple additive components in e-liquid, the problem of difficulty in simultaneously detecting multiple e-liquid additives in existing technologies has been solved, achieving rapid and accurate screening results.

Abstract

This utility model provides a screening device for prohibited additives in e-liquid, characterized in that it includes: a base with a mounting structure; a screening module mounted on the mounting structure of the base and detachably connected; and several sample inlets mounted on the screening module. The screening module contains built-in test strips with its ends facing the sample inlets. Samples can be taken using several droppers, placed in the sample inlets, and detected by the screening module to determine the presence of prohibited additives.

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to a screening instrument for prohibited additives in e-liquid. Background Technology

[0002] E-liquid (used in e-cigarettes or heated tobacco products) is typically composed of propylene glycol (PG), glycerin (VG), nicotine, flavorings, and other additives.

[0003] - Additives may include: Flavoring agents (such as menthol, fruit flavorings); Functional agents (such as thickeners and humectants); Potentially harmful substances (such as formaldehyde, acetaldehyde, nitrosamines, heavy metals, etc.).

[0004] In existing technologies, it is difficult to detect multiple traits in a single test. Summary of the Invention

[0015] The following are specific embodiments of the present invention, and the technical solution of the present invention will be further described in conjunction with the accompanying drawings.

[0016] like Figure 1-3 As shown, a screening device for prohibited additives in e-liquid is characterized in that it comprises: Base 1, wherein the base 1 has a mounting structure; A screening module, which is mounted on the mounting structure of the base 1 and is detachably connected; The storage port 4 has several ports and is installed on the screening module; The screening module has a built-in test strip 3 with its end facing the placement port 4.

[0017] This application involves sliding the test item through the detection channel 23 onto the test strip 3 in the test strip installation chamber 25, displaying the test result through the test strip 3, and detecting the presence of additives. The test strip 3 in each test strip installation chamber 25 can be disassembled and replaced.

[0018] Furthermore, the mounting structure is a mounting cavity 12, which is elongated and has snap-fit ​​structures 11 around its perimeter. The entire screening module is detachable.

[0019] Furthermore, the screening module includes a mounting base 2, a test strip mounting chamber 25, and a detection channel 23. The detection channel 23 is inclined and has a fixing post 24 that is vertically fixed on the mounting base 2. The test strip mounting chamber 25 has several units and adjacent units are fixedly connected. The test strip mounting chamber 25 is snapped into the mounting base 2, and the mounting base 2 is snapped into the mounting cavity 12 by a snap-fit ​​pin 21.

[0020] Furthermore, the mounting base 2 has a mounting groove 22 for the test strip mounting compartment 25 to be inserted. The test strip mounting compartment 25 is removable, facilitating the replacement of the test strip 3.

[0021] Furthermore, the inlet 4 is cylindrical, and the detection channel 23 is located within the inlet 4. The detection channel 23 is needle-shaped with a sharp end. The sharp end of the detection channel 23 facilitates insertion into the end of the dropper 5 (described below), allowing the sample to flow in easily.

[0022] Furthermore, the kit includes several droppers 5, a reagent kit 52, and several aspiration probes. The end of the dropper 5 can be connected to the aspiration probe, and the aspiration probe can be inserted into the reagent kit 52.

[0023] Furthermore, the dropper 5 is threadedly connected to the aspiration probe. This threaded connection facilitates the insertion of the aspiration probe into the sample to be extracted.
